It took a while, but Steven Fogarty is finally a member of the New York Rangers.
Fogarty, New York’s third-round pick at the 2011 draft, has finally agreed to his entry-level deal. The Notre Dame captain signed on Tuesday, just one day after another “experienced” collegiate draftee -- University of Michigan forward Cristoval “Boo” Nieves -- also signed his ELC.
Like Nieves, Fogarty -- a forward -- will report immediately to the Rangers’ AHL affiliate in Hartford, and play out the year on an amateur tryout contract.
Fogarty just turned 22 and has spent the last four years with the Fighting Irish. He’s captained the club in each of the last two campaigns and had a productive senior year, offensively speaking -- career-highs in goals (10) and points (23) in 37 games.
